Idealizations
The cognitive process of perceiving others, oneself, or situations in an overly positive way, ignoring potential negative aspects.
Psychosexual Development
Freud's theory on how personality develops during childhood through a series of stages centered on erogenous zones.
Avoiding Relationships
A behavior pattern where an individual actively distances themselves from forming close or intimate relationships with others.
Transitional Object
An object, often a soft toy or blanket, used by children to provide psychological comfort in times of stress or change.
